      PfSense 2.4.4p2+E2Guardian5 system. Wifi network, whatsapp voice call or video call not working. Realtime log, Tcp_dump/403 https://127.0.0.1

      But E5Guardian SSL support disable; smoothly working.

      Why?

      P 1 Reply Last reply Reply Quote 0
      • P
        pfsensation @plusbil
        last edited by

        @plusbil said in Unofficial E2guardian package for pfSense:

        PfSense 2.4.4p2+E2Guardian5 system. Wifi network, whatsapp voice call or video call not working. Realtime log, Tcp_dump/403 https://127.0.0.1

        But E5Guardian SSL support disable; smoothly working.

        Why?

        Age old issue of SSL pinning, apps reject any certs other than the one baked in by the app dev when they built the app. This is to try mitigate the MITM attacks, which is what E2 Guardian does.

        Just make an alias to let Whatsapp bypass E2 Guardian altogether.

                                I'm running pfsense 2.4.4-RELEASE-p2, after running the command on page 1, I am still not able to see E2guardian package as an option for install, even after a reboot, what am i missing?

                                P 1 Reply Last reply Reply Quote 0
                                • P
                                  pfsensation @arch113
                                  last edited by

                                  @arch113 said in Unofficial E2guardian package for pfSense:

                                  I'm running pfsense 2.4.4-RELEASE-p2, after running the command on page 1, I am still not able to see E2guardian package as an option for install, even after a reboot, what am i missing?

                                  You're missing the patch that enables packages from unofficial sources to be shown.

                                  arch113A 1 Reply Last reply Reply Quote 0
                                  • P
                                    pfsensation @User43617
                                    last edited by

                                    @user43617 said in Unofficial E2guardian package for pfSense:

                                    Which list are you using. Shallalalist seems to be missing some things. It is unclear if it, or the french one, is still maintained.

                                    Squidblacklist is interesting. Can anyone attest to its efficacy? Or, in other words, is it worth the price of the subscription?

                                    I'm currently using https://dsi.ut-capitole.fr/blacklists/ it's French. However works well for English domains too and I've found it to be much better than Shallalist.

                                    1 Reply Last reply Reply Quote 0
                                    • arch113A
                                      arch113 @pfsensation
                                      last edited by

                                      @pfsensation said in Unofficial E2guardian package for pfSense:

                                      @arch113 said in Unofficial E2guardian package for pfSense:

                                      I'm running pfsense 2.4.4-RELEASE-p2, after running the command on page 1, I am still not able to see E2guardian package as an option for install, even after a reboot, what am i missing?

                                      You're missing the patch that enables packages from unofficial sources to be shown.

                                      How do I do that? I ran "fetch -q -o /usr/local/etc/pkg/repos/Unofficial.conf https://raw.githubusercontent.com/marcelloc/Unofficial-pfSense-packages/master/Unofficial.conf"

                                      P 1 Reply Last reply Reply Quote 0
                                      • P
                                        pfsensation @arch113
                                        last edited by

                                        @arch113 Download the system patches package and copy and paste everything in here: https://github.com/marcelloc/Unofficial-pfSense-packages/blob/master/244_unofficial_packages_list.patch

                                        Then give your system a reboot and the packages will show.
